4.3
Verify Installation
After completing the installation, please verify the following items:
There are 5~10cm of clearance around the sides of the device for ventilation and the
■
air flow is adequate.
The voltage of the power supply meets the requirement of the input voltage of the device.
■
The power socket, device and rack are well grounded.
■
The device is correctly connected to other network devices.
■
